Pakadarha is a Rural village located in Gharghoda, Raigarh, Chhattisgarh.
The total population of Pakadarha is 363.
Pakadarha village comprises 92 households.
The literacy rate in Pakadarha is 51.6%. Among the literate population of 147, there are 84 literate males and 63 literate females.
In Pakadarha, there are 175 males and 188 females, with a sex ratio of 1074 females per 1000 males.
There are 78 children (21.5% of population), comprising 41 boys and 37 girls.
The total number of workers in Pakadarha is 178, with 147 main workers and 31 marginal workers.
In Pakadarha, there are 125 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(54 males, 71 females) and 211 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(107 males, 104 females).
Pakadarha is located in Chhattisgarh state, Raigarh district, and falls under Gharghoda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 434697 and LGD code is 434697.
